Bright ruby-red. Aromas of blackberry, licorice, violet and smoke, plus a whiff of animal fur. Juicy and sweet but a bit youthfully brooding, with good inner-mouth lift and definition and a distinct meaty component following through on the palate. Finishes with dusty tannins. (3/ 2009)
Eventide is the second label of Mishca Estate. A deep garnet color and a spicy nose of blackberry and plum are underscored by tones of olive, cinnamon, and cedar. Structured tannins overlay a juicy palate with good acidity and a long finish reverberating the fruit.
